The S&P 500 Index erased early gains to finish lower as a decline in Apple Inc. and Tesla Inc. offset advances elsewhere. Chipmakers rebounded ahead of a deluge of earnings reports that will test whether Big Tech’s profits can match high expectations.
The equities benchmark slipped 0.2%. Apple and Tesla were the biggest point decliners in the S&P 500, keeping broader market gains in check after the iPhone maker briefly overtook Nvidia Corp. as the world’s most valuable company on Friday. The Nasdaq 100 Index eked out a gain of less than 0.1%, led by semiconductor companies, after its worst week in almost a month. The Philadelphia Stock Exchange Semiconductor Index gained 0.6% after falling into a bear market last week.
